The Delhi High Court on Monday heard a petition filed by means of Turkey-based corporate Celebi Airport Services India Pvt Ltd towards the revocation of its safety clearance by means of the Bureau of Civil Aviation Security (BCAS). The clearance was once revoked on May 15, bringing up “national security” issues, days after Turkey sponsored Pakistan amid tensions between India and Pakistan.

Justice Sachin Datta’s unmarried bench remarked, “The rule is better safe than sorry,” emphasizing the significance of nationwide safety. The court docket’s remark got here as senior suggest Mukul Rohatgi, representing Celebi, argued that public belief can’t be used to remove employment.

Celebi has operated within the Indian aviation sector for over 17 years, providing services and products at 9 airports and using over 10,000 other folks. The corporate handles round 58,000 flights and 5,40,000 tonnes of shipment yearly in India.

Solicitor General Tushar Mehta, showing for the Centre, argued that nationwide safety and sovereignty of the country are at stake. He emphasised that the precise to factor and revoke safety clearance lies only with the Civil Aviation Ministry, which reserves the precise to revoke clearance with out specifying causes.

Mehta stressed out that during issues involving nationwide safety, there can’t be a “doctrine of proportionality.” He highlighted the significance of civil aviation safety, declaring that safety companies will have to prevail on all events, whilst the enemy must prevail most effective as soon as.

The bench noticed that serving a previous understand would possibly end up counter-productive amid apprehensions over nationwide safety, doubtlessly hastening the very motion being apprehended.

The High Court adjourned the topic until May 21 and requested the Centre to elucidate beneath which provisions it revoked the safety clearance to Celebi. Celebi’s plea argues that “vague” nationwide safety issues have been cited with out reasoning.

The controversy has sparked calls to boycott Turkey and Azerbaijan, that have supported Pakistan amid the India-Pakistan tensions. Travel internet sites have reported a decline in bookings and build up in cancellations for visits to the 2 nations. The Confederation of All India Traders has additionally determined to boycott all business and business engagement with Turkey and Azerbaijan.
